    Parents are stepping up and exerting their parental rights and I, for one, am so happy to see this. They are attempting to bring common sense and the inalienable rights of parents back to education. As Estada says: "Parents know they have the right to be in charge of their child's education, upbringing, and care. This is not just a Republican issue or even a Christian issue. This is something parents all across the board want. They may have different views on how to raise their children, but we respect that and we advance it and we protect it legally here in our country."

    I strongly support a Parent's Bill of Rights. The Coalition for Public Education group (C.O.P.E.) strongly supports a Parent's Bill of Rights. The fact that parents are getting out of the kitchen, out of the house, and out to local school boards meetings all across the country because of their outrage and frustration over what is happening in the public school system, to the detriment of students, to the dismantling of the child-parent relationship, and to the integrity of education in general should impress upon boards of education the seriousness of the matter. Parents matter. Their rights matter. Children matter. The education of our next generation matters. Boards of Education, state legislators, and even our legislators in DC need to recognize and support a Parent's Bill of Rights.
